           Here are some tips (建议) on how to stay safe in earthquakes (地震).
          1. Stay inside and duck and cover. Get under a desk or table, or stand in a corner or under a doorway.
    Cover your head and neck with your arms.
          2. Move against a wall if in a high building with no protective desk or table nearby. Cover your head and
    neck with your arms. 
          3. Try to get into an open area away from trees, buildings, walls, and power lines (电杆) if outdoors. 
          4. Pull over (停靠) to the side of the road away from overpasses (天桥) and power lines if driving. Stay in
    your car until the shaking ends.
          5. Get away from shelves or other areas where objects may fall if in a crowded store or public area. Do
    not run for the door. Lower your body close to the ground and cover your head and neck with your hands and
    arms.
          6. Stay in your seat if in a cinema or a theater. Get below the level of the back of the seat and cover your
    head and neck with your arms. 
          7. If you take cover (躲避) under a strong piece of furniture,hold on to it and be prepared to move with
    it. 
          8. Try to stay away from kitchens, where there are often many objects that might fall or get burnt.
